Guys I think my latest antweight might be overweight:
Image
Image
Image
Image

That's not the final ram it will be using (It just happens to be the exact length needed), I have a better one lined up I'm buying off of Will. Again a big thanks to Peter for giving me the drive motors. Geeza from the FRA forum donated the chassis and once I switch the sprocket for a gear on the motor (and go through the standard battle hardening), sort out the pneumatics and an ESC I should be good to go. Will be giving the chassis some good TLC first though including a repaint in Team Shakey colours and any extra weight poured into armour. I have 4x 8cell A123 packs for batteries. So far I've spent £90 (including the ram).
